Drying Function
One of the primary roles of an air knife in a flexo printing machine is drying. After the printing process, the ink on the substrate needs to dry quickly to prevent smudging, offsetting, and ensure sharp and clear images. Air knives blow a high - velocity, uniform stream of air across the printed surface. This rapid airflow accelerates the evaporation of the solvent or water in the ink, speeding up the drying process.
For instance, in a high - speed flexo printing operation, where the substrate is moving at a fast pace, traditional drying methods may not be sufficient. The air knife can be precisely adjusted to direct the air at the right angle and with the appropriate force to dry the ink before the substrate reaches the next stage of the printing process or is wound up. This is especially important when using water - based inks, which generally take longer to dry compared to solvent - based inks. The air knife helps to reduce the drying time, increasing the overall productivity of the flexo printing machine.
Dust and Debris Removal
Another critical role of the air knife is to remove dust and debris from the substrate before and after the printing process. Dust and debris on the substrate can cause a variety of problems in flexo printing. They can get trapped in the ink, resulting in uneven printing, dots, or other defects in the printed image.
Before the printing process, the air knife can be used to blow away any loose particles on the substrate surface. This ensures that the ink adheres properly to the substrate and that the printing quality is not compromised. After printing, the air knife can also remove any loose ink particles or debris that may have accumulated on the printed surface. This helps to keep the printed product clean and free of contaminants, improving its overall appearance and quality.
Web Handling and Tension Control
Air knives can also contribute to web handling and tension control in a flexo printing machine. The high - velocity air stream from the air knife can be used to guide the substrate through the printing machine. By adjusting the position and force of the air knife, the operator can ensure that the substrate moves smoothly through the various printing stations without wrinkling or sagging.
In addition, air knives can help to maintain proper tension in the substrate. In a flexo printing machine, maintaining the right tension in the substrate is crucial for accurate printing registration. If the tension is too high, the substrate may break; if it is too low, the substrate may wrinkle or cause misregistration. The air knife can be used to apply a controlled amount of force on the substrate, helping to keep the tension within the desired range.
Comparison with Other Drying and Cleaning Methods
Compared to other drying and cleaning methods, air knives offer several advantages. For example, compared to infrared dryers, air knives are more energy - efficient. Infrared dryers use a significant amount of energy to generate heat, while air knives mainly rely on compressed air or a blower to generate the high - velocity air stream. This makes air knives a more cost - effective option in the long run.
When it comes to cleaning, air knives are more precise and less invasive than traditional cleaning methods such as brushing or wiping. Brushing or wiping can sometimes damage the substrate or the printing plate, while the air knife uses a non - contact method to remove dust and debris. This reduces the risk of damage to the printing components and the substrate, ensuring a longer lifespan for the flexo printing machine.
Applications in Different Types of Flexo Printing Machines
The role of the air knife is applicable across different types of flexo printing machines. Whether it is a Three Color Printing Machine, a Four Color Printing Machine, or a Six Color Printing Machine, the air knife can enhance the performance of the machine.
In multi - color flexo printing machines, the air knife is particularly important for drying each color layer before the next color is applied. This ensures that the colors do not mix or bleed into each other, resulting in a sharp and vibrant printed image. The air knife also helps to maintain the consistency of the printing quality across all color stations, regardless of the complexity of the printing job.
